Running K: Difference between revisions
Content added Content deleted
No edit summary |
(add k2) |
||
Line 19: | Line 19: | ||
| ThePlatform || [https://theplatform.technology/webrepl.htm REPL] |
| ThePlatform || [https://theplatform.technology/webrepl.htm REPL] |
||
|- |
|- |
||
|k7(kparc) |
|k7 (kparc) |
||
|https://kparc.io/kc/ |
|https://kparc.io/kc/ |
||
|- |
|- |
||
|k9(kparc) |
|k9 (kparc) |
||
|https://kparc.io/k/ |
|https://kparc.io/k/ |
||
|- |
|||
|k2 (nsl archive) |
|||
|http://nsl.com/k/k2/k295/ |
|||
|} |
|} |
||
Revision as of 05:41, 11 February 2022
K was originally created as a proprietary language, but the main implementations are freely available to the general public for personal use. Over the years, many open source implementations of K have emerged.
Web-based interpreters
Name | Links |
---|---|
ngn/k | Editor REPL nextjournal * |
oK | REPL editor(iKe drawing framework) |
Special K | Online GLSL shader mapping |
Kona | repl.it |
ktye/i | REPL |
ThePlatform | REPL |
k7 (kparc) | https://kparc.io/kc/ |
k9 (kparc) | https://kparc.io/k/ |
k2 (nsl archive) | http://nsl.com/k/k2/k295/ |
Try It Online! is an online programming environment which supports ngn/k, oK and Kona. It is not listed in the table since the owner has not updated the K versions for years.
Table of Implementations
Name | Language | Dialect | License | Download |
---|---|---|---|---|
Shakti | C | K9 | proprietary | https://shakti.com/ |
ThePlatform | Rust | K-like | temporarily closed source | https://theplatform.technology/platform/install.html |
ktye/i | Go | K-like | public domain(no license) | https://github.com/ktye/i |
ngn/k | C | K6 | AGPL3 | https://codeberg.org/ngn/k |
oK | JS | K6 | MIT | https://github.com/JohnEarnest/ok |
kuc | C | K5-like | GPL3 | https://github.com/zholos/kuc/ |
kdb+/q | unknown | K4 | proprietary | https://kx.com/developers/download-licenses/ |
klong | C | K-like | public domain | https://t3x.org/klong/ |
Kona | C | K3 | ISC | https://github.com/kevinlawler/kona/ |